NAPLES, Italy :Defending champions Napoli moved provisionally top of the Serie A standings after a 3-1 home win over Atalanta on Saturday, with David Neres scoring a first-half double to send the hosts on their way to a largely comfortable victory.
BOLOGNA, Italy :Six-times champions Spain edged past Germany 2-1 on Saturday to reach their first Davis Cup final since 2019, with their doubles pair Marcel Granollers and Pedro Martinez clinching a 6-2 3-6 6-3 win over Kevin Krawietz and Tim Puetz in the decisive match.
MUNICH, Germany :Champions Bayern Munich raced from two goals down to crush visitors Freiburg 6-2 in the Bundesliga on Saturday, with Michael Olise scoring twice to maintain their unbeaten run and keep them clear at the top of the standings.
BARCELONA :Ferran Torres struck twice as Barcelona marked their long-awaited return to their Camp Nou Stadium with an emphatic 4-0 win over Athletic Bilbao on Saturday.

Unheralded French skier Paco Rassat earned his first career World Cup victory Saturday in Gurgl, Austria, winning the second slalom of the Olympic season thanks to a blistering second run.
Canadian short track speed skaters continued to skate their way onto the World Tour podium on Saturday in Gdansk, Poland.
